2. Compatibility

This replacement side discharge chute (OEM part number 543958001) is specifically designed for the following Ryobi 40V 20" Cordless Mower models:

  • RY401017VNM (also known as RY401170)
  • RY401018VNM (also known as RY401180)
  • HLPM04VNM
  • HLPM05VNM

Ensure your mower model matches one of the listed compatible models before proceeding with installation.

4. Installation (Setup)

Follow these steps to install the replacement side discharge chute:

  1. Prepare the Mower: Ensure the mower is turned off and the battery pack is removed. Place the mower on a flat, stable surface.
  2. Locate Discharge Opening: Identify the side discharge opening on your Ryobi 40V 20" cordless mower.
  3. Remove Old Chute (if applicable): If replacing an existing chute, carefully detach it from its mounting points. Note how the old chute was attached.
  4. Position New Chute: Align the new YYBParts side discharge chute with the mounting points on the mower's deck. The chute is designed to fit securely into the designated slots or hinges.
  5. Secure the Chute: Gently push or snap the chute into place until it is firmly seated. Ensure all clips or tabs engage properly. The installation is typically a bolt-on or snap-in process, depending on the specific mower model's design.
  6. Verify Installation: Once installed, gently tug on the chute to ensure it is securely attached and does not wobble. It should sit flush against the mower deck.

7.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your side discharge chute, consider the following:

  • Chute Does Not Fit:
    • Verify your mower model number against the compatibility list in Section 2.
    • Ensure you are aligning the chute correctly with the mower's discharge opening and attachment points.
  • Grass Clogging in Chute:
    • Grass may be too tall or wet. Try mowing when grass is dry and at a slower pace.
    • The mower blade may be dull. A sharp blade cuts more efficiently and reduces clogging.
    • Clean any existing buildup inside the chute.
  • Chute Feels Loose After Installation:
    • Re-check all attachment points to ensure they are fully engaged. Some models may have specific clips or pins that need to be secured.
    • Inspect the mower's discharge opening for any damage that might prevent a secure fit.
